Output 34bdb0861f13b65d8b52d82d4a9150ff76c26a2a1a29b4add79372f601ebba32:81

value
3586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e796050617704ae15210c7b872d07ced55ca97c6974606683838e3c794848460
address
bc1pu7tq2pshwp9wz5ssc7u895rua42u497xjarqv6pc8r3u09yys3sq395y35
transaction
34bdb0861f13b65d8b52d82d4a9150ff76c26a2a1a29b4add79372f601ebba32
spent
true